"It folds down to the size of a credit card" - Razer's mobile controllers were getting too bulky so it's launching a foldable one you can carry around in your pocket

Razer has launched the Razer Prio, a new foldable mobile controller designed for ultimate portability, folding down to the size of a credit card. While it aims to balance portability and precision, its $99.99 price point is considered high compared to other mobile controllers on the market. The controller features contactless capacitive analog thumbsticks to prevent stick drift and supports phones up to 7 inches.

Genki’s Manta Controller Packs A Small Mountain Of Features Into A Single Gamepad

Genki has launched a new controller, the Manta, which features a 2.9-inch LCD screen for customization and an array of advanced hardware. The controller's Kickstarter campaign has surpassed its $100,000 goal, reaching over $371,000. It will be compatible with PC and Nintendo Switch consoles and includes features like adjustable triggers, drift-resistant analog sticks, and advanced haptics.

The Scuf Omega feels gorgeous in the hands, but those side buttons aren't all they're cracked up to be

The Scuf Omega is a premium PlayStation 5 controller offering fast, tactile mechanical buttons and excellent customization options, particularly for PC users. While it boasts a comfortable grip and satisfying controls, its side buttons can be awkwardly placed and prone to accidental presses, and the thin top plate raises durability concerns. It competes with other high-end controllers like the Razer Raiju V3 Pro, with the choice often coming down to specific feature preferences and current pricing.

'Basically Lego for gamers': This new game controller has modular buttons, sticks, grips, and even vibration…

Beitong has unveiled its PanGu controller, described as 'Lego for gamers,' featuring modular joysticks, buttons, grips, and vibration motors that can be swapped without tools. The controller supports up to 1,000 Hz polling rate and is compatible with PC, Nintendo Switch, Android, and iOS. While the design is noted as blocky, its customization options are extensive, with pricing for bundles reportedly exceeding $100.

It's Sugar Whirl vs Lavender Dusk: GameSir and 8BitDo go head-to-head with colorful new Xbox controllers - but…

GameSir and 8BitDo have launched new officially licensed Xbox controllers, the T7 Pro and Ultimate 3 respectively, with similar color schemes and pricing. Both controllers offer wireless connectivity via USB dongle or Bluetooth, and feature Hall effect triggers. The 8BitDo Ultimate 3 includes adjustable thumbstick tension and additional bumper buttons, while the GameSir T7 Pro features four rumble motors and RGB lighting.
